Started the day with a HU's and for the 1st 20 hands I had a small chip lead. On hand 21 I had Ah Kd on the BT and Open-Raised 2 BB and was RR to 100. I decided to just call. The other player is from Russia so I suspect he has an Ace. The Flop 5s 6s Ad. I pair my Ace w/a pretty good kicker. BB bets 120 into the 200 pot and I just call. I've decided to slow play my hand BUT the BB could easily be going with Ax where x is a rag (low) card. Turn Qd. BB bets 260 into the 440 pot and I just call again. I'm not too worried about the Q. River 5d. I don't like that card as I put him on Ax and if he had a 5 he would have trip 5's OR a FH. I'm not worried about his having a flush. He bets only 230 into the 960 pot, which is pretty low if he has a winning hand, but he could be low betting hoping I don't fold and will give him something. I just call since with one pair there are a lot of ways he could beat me. He shows Ac 9h. Pretty much the kind of hand I expected his to have. I win and now have a nice chip lead.

Fast forward to the last hand. This was a very iffy one for me to call and I was very lucky on the River.
I'm on the BT w/KcKd, BB only has 640 chips left. I decide to slow play my pocket K's and hope the BB hits something worthwhile that will let me win all his chips. He just calls. Flop Kh Qh Ah. Yuck. Not the kind of hand I want to see. I now have a very nice set but the board shows a possible made flush that I have no part of. BB checks and I make a min bet of 30 into the 60 pot. BB check-raises to 90 and I decide to RR to 210 which should give a pretty idea of how much in love with the hearts flop he is. Rats, he RR All-In. He could be on a flush draw, but much more likely he has the made flush. It will cost me 430 in chips to call him and if I can somehow win this session is over. If I lose he'll be well back into the game. I think about it for awhile, and decide to go for it. The worse case scenario he'll double up; I'm hoping he'll only be on a draw. And, as I likely expected, he has the made flush with Jh 6h. Now I can just hope for a 4th K or the board doubles up to give me a FH. Turn 8d. Not looking good. River Ad. WOW, I hit it and session is over. Phew!!
